Title: The Innovative Mind of Andrew F Sirois
Introduction
Andrew F Sirois is a notable inventor based in Lawrence, MA (US). He has made significant contributions to the field of industrial processes through his innovative designs and inventions. His work primarily focuses on enhancing the interaction between humans and machines, which is crucial in modern industrial settings.
Latest Patents
One of Andrew F Sirois's key patents is a man-machine interface designed for use with industrial processes. This interface allows for the design and configuration of the interrelationship of components that form an overall industrial process. It provides operators with capabilities for process monitoring and control, as well as alarm annunciation. Most user interactions with this interface are conducted through a color CRT monitor equipped with a touch panel. The design allows for limited touch panel interaction for operators, while configurators and designers can also utilize a keyboard. The interface employs distributed processing and incorporates a high-level graphic language, facilitating real-time graphic display implementation through dynamic and static variables. This innovative approach allows for variable types to dynamically associate with variable values, enabling type changes without negative effects. Additionally, the interface features a new bus structure, including a unique bus arbitration technique, a unidirectional memory boundary protection mechanism, an improved interrupt system, and an enhanced watchdog timer circuit.
